你查询的IP:[203.95.60.159]  地理位置:日本

最新查询222.168.85.68 210.28.211.208 218.64.120.89 218.150.151.181 124.88.246.97 220.252.90.175 220.160.60.85 124.88.73.162 203.148.44.128 203.95.60.159 116.214.32.238 203.208.32.163 202.92.252.19 210.26.175.152 125.58.128.61 124.47.79.141 202.122.32.102 117.58.205.194 117.8.178.20 192.83.122.181 202.4.252.117 218.127.231.176 119.42.224.200 58.30.221.224 202.173.224.75 118.84.139.229 121.55.210.243 117.76.55.243 122.98.64.178 124.250.226.226 116.208.172.234